When asked for more information about the guide, the reasons behind creating a guide on Surviving Infidelity and what she hopes to accomplish with it, Caroline Madden, Owner at Counseling With Caroline (couples counselor in Burbank) said: “Betrayed women do things that at the time seem like good ideas (tell the whole world about the affair, tell the kids, tell the husband’s work, have an affair themselves), but when they finally get off the reactionary emotional roller coaster, they regret those decisions made out of anger. They make an already terrible situation worse. They compound their husband’s selfish emotional choice to cheat even worse with their own reactions. Sadly, the children end up being the ultimate losers when women respond with vengefulness instead of calmly and rationally figuring out the best path forward. This book help create a logical action plan.
